SILVERLESS STREET 1.
5407 (South Side) No 17 (Church Cottage) SU 1869 1/308 II GV 2.
Cl8. Red brick, with some grey headers. Pitched tile roof. 2 storeys. Brick modillion eaves cornice. 3 casements with glazing bars on lst floor. 2 sashes with glazing bars (left hand cl8, right hand C19) and 1 segmental bay window with glazing bars and Cl8 glass on ground floor. Modern door in original segment-headed opening.
Nos 17 and 18 form a group with no 1, opposite, and with Nos 1, 2, 4 to 11 (consec), and Nos 40 to 48A (consec), Kingsbury Street.
